The Comprehensive Guide to Legally Obtaining a Driving License
Driving is a fundamental skill for lots of, offering the freedom to take a trip where and when you desire, frequently making life easier and pleasurable. Nevertheless, acquiring a driving license is a process that requires understanding, perseverance, and adherence to legal treatments. This guide intends to offer an in-depth introduction of the steps one must follow to legally acquire a driving license, highlighting essential factors to consider and frequently asked questions to guarantee a smooth and hassle-free experience.
Understanding the Basics
Before diving into the application process, it's important to understand the fundamental requirements and kinds of driving licenses available. Driving laws vary significantly from country to nation, and even within different states or provinces within the same country. Normally, there are a number of kinds of driving licenses, consisting of:
- Learner's Permit: This is frequently the primary step while doing so, enabling new drivers to get experience under supervision.
- Provisional License: Issued after passing a basic driving test, this license normally comes with limitations and is a stepping stone to a full license.
- Full Driver's License: Once all the necessary requirements are fulfilled, motorists can acquire a complete license, which offers total driving privileges.
- Commercial Driver's License (CDL): Required for those who wish to operate commercial vehicles, such as trucks or buses.
Steps to Obtain a Driving License
1. Research Study Local Driving Laws
The initial step in obtaining a driving license is to look into the particular requirements in your location. Visit the main website of your local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) or comparable company to find comprehensive details about the licensing procedure, including age restrictions, required documents, and charges.
2. Prepare Required Documentation
Each jurisdiction has its own set of files that need to be sent to obtain a driving license. Typically required documents include:
- Proof of Identity: A passport, birth certificate, or state-issued ID.
- Evidence of Residency: Utility expenses, lease arrangements, or other official files that verify your address.
- Social Security Number (if applicable): In some nations, a social security number or equivalent is needed for identification.
- Vision Test Results: Some places require a vision test before issuing a learner's authorization or license.
3. Take a Driver's Education Course
Many states and nations require new chauffeurs to complete a driver's education course. These courses are developed to teach the guidelines of the roadway, traffic laws, and safe driving practices. They can be finished online or in a classroom setting and typically include both theoretical and practical parts.
4. Request a Learner's Permit
As soon as the needed paperwork is prepared and the driver's education course is finished, the next step is to get a learner's authorization. This typically involves visiting the DMV or submitting an application online. You will likewise need to pass a written test that covers traffic laws and driving understanding.
5. Practice Driving
With a learner's authorization, you can begin practicing driving under the supervision of a licensed grownup. This is an essential step in constructing your confidence and skills behind the wheel. It's likewise essential to gain experience in various driving conditions, such as night driving, highway driving, and driving in inclement weather condition.
6. Schedule and Pass the Driving Test
After gaining adequate driving experience, you can arrange a driving test with the DMV. The test will evaluate your capability to securely operate an automobile and follow traffic laws. You will need to bring a correctly registered and guaranteed lorry to the test, and the examiner will examine your driving skills on a predetermined route.
7. Look for a Provisional License
If you pass the driving test, you will usually get a provisionary license. This license may include constraints, such as a curfew or a limitation on the number of passengers you can have in the lorry. These restrictions are created to reduce the risk of mishaps and assist new motorists adapt to the roadway.
8. Update to a Full License
When you have actually held a provisional license for the necessary period and fulfilled any extra requirements, you can update to a full driver's license. This procedure typically includes an easy application and might require a retest or additional documents.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q: What is the minimum age to make an application for a student's license?
A: The minimum age varies by jurisdiction. In the United States, it usually ranges from 15 to 16 years old. In the UK, the minimum age is 17. Check your local DMV site for particular details.
Q: Can I get a driver's license online?

Q: What occurs if I fail the driving test?
A: If you stop working the driving test, you can typically retake it after a particular duration. This duration differs by location, but it is frequently a couple of weeks. It's a good idea to practice more before retaking the test to enhance your opportunities of success.
Q: Can I drive alone with a learner's license?

Q: Is a vision test needed to get a driving license?
A: Yes, most jurisdictions need a vision test to make sure that you can safely operate a lorry. You can normally take this test at the DMV or with an authorized optometrist.
Q: How long does it take to get a full driver's license?
A: The time needed to obtain a complete driver's license differs depending upon your jurisdiction and the specific actions involved. Typically, it can take numerous months, consisting of the time needed to complete a driver's education course, hold a learner's permit, and pass the driving test.
Q: Can I utilize a provisionary license to drive for work?
A: It depends on the constraints put on your provisional license. Some provisionary licenses permit you to drive for work, while others might have specific restrictions. Inspect your license for details or contact the DMV for explanation.
Q: What is the distinction in between a student's license and a provisional license?
A: A learner's authorization is the very first phase of the licensing procedure and permits you to drive just under supervision. A provisionary license, on the other hand, grants you more driving privileges however might still have some restrictions, such as a curfew or guest limitations.
Q: Can I make an application for a business driver's license (CDL) without a full driver's license?

Q: What should I do if I lose my driving license?
A: If you lose your driving license, you need to report it to the DMV and request a replacement. You may need to offer proof of identity and pay a charge. It's also a good idea to inform your insurance coverage company and any other appropriate celebrations.
